The Yamaha G1 Golf cart, equipped with a 215cc engine, has a bore of 70 mm and a stroke of 65 mm. This configuration contributes to the engine's performance in terms of power and torque output. The specific dimensions are integral to the engine's design and efficiency in a golf cart application.

Bore = the (internal) diameter of the cylnder hole in the engine block. Stroke = the distance the piston travels up (or down) the bore during its' cycle. If you multiply the bore dimension by the stroke dimension you will get the volumetric displacement of that cylinder. thus, Vd = (3.1416/4) (dia.) squared x Stroke
